About Prestwood

Prestwood is a village located in Staffordshire, England, within the DY7 postcode area. It is situated near the larger town of Stourbridge, making it accessible for those looking to explore the surrounding region. The village features a mix of residential homes and local amenities, providing a convenient setting for everyday life. The area is characterised by its green spaces and proximity to nature, offering opportunities for outdoor activities such as walking and cycling. Prestwood is served by local schools and shops, catering to the needs of its residents. The village has a friendly community atmosphere, making it a pleasant place to live or visit.
